Climate Change and the Public Service Commission: A Critical Examination of Their Response

Climate change is no longer a distant threat; it's a present reality impacting communities worldwide. From extreme weather events to rising sea levels, the consequences are undeniable. But how effectively are regulatory bodies, such as Public Service Commissions (PSCs), responding to this urgent crisis? This article critically examines the role of PSCs in addressing climate change and explores the challenges and opportunities they face.

The Role of Public Service Commissions in Climate Action

Public Service Commissions, responsible for regulating essential services like electricity, gas, and water, hold a pivotal role in mitigating climate change. Their regulatory powers allow them to influence energy production, distribution, and consumption, driving the transition towards cleaner and more sustainable energy sources. This includes:

  • Promoting renewable energy integration: PSCs can incentivize the development and adoption of renewable energy technologies like solar, wind, and geothermal power through various regulatory mechanisms, including renewable portfolio standards (RPS).
  • Improving energy efficiency: Implementing energy efficiency standards for buildings and appliances can significantly reduce energy consumption and carbon emissions. PSCs can play a key role in setting and enforcing these standards.
  • Modernizing the electricity grid: A modernized grid, capable of efficiently integrating renewable energy sources and managing fluctuating energy supplies, is crucial for a successful energy transition. PSCs can facilitate investments in grid modernization projects.
  • Investing in smart grid technologies: Smart grid technologies offer significant opportunities for enhanced grid management, improved energy efficiency, and integration of distributed generation resources. PSCs can encourage the adoption of these technologies.

Challenges Faced by PSCs in Addressing Climate Change

Despite their significant potential, PSCs face several challenges in effectively tackling climate change:

  • Political influence and lobbying: Powerful fossil fuel interests often lobby against stricter regulations, hindering the implementation of ambitious climate policies.
  • Short-term economic considerations: The transition to a clean energy system requires significant upfront investments. PSCs may prioritize short-term economic stability over long-term sustainability goals.
  • Lack of technical expertise: Navigating the complex technical aspects of climate change mitigation and adaptation requires specialized knowledge. Some PSCs may lack the necessary expertise to make informed decisions.
  • Data limitations: Accurate and reliable data on greenhouse gas emissions and the effectiveness of climate policies are essential for informed decision-making. Data gaps can hinder effective regulation.

Moving Forward: Recommendations for PSCs

To effectively address climate change, PSCs need to:

  • Embrace a long-term perspective: Prioritize long-term sustainability goals over short-term economic gains.
  • Strengthen technical expertise: Invest in training and resources to build internal expertise on climate change issues.
  • Enhance transparency and public participation: Foster open communication and engagement with stakeholders to build consensus and support for climate action.
  • Collaborate with other stakeholders: Work closely with other government agencies, industry stakeholders, and environmental groups to develop effective climate policies.
  • Utilize innovative financing mechanisms: Explore new financial tools to support clean energy investments and reduce the financial burden on ratepayers.
